Vivo is currently working on its next generation flagship smartphone series called the Vivo X300 series and the same is expected to be announced in October this year. The reliable tipster DCS (Digital Chat Station), as well as ACE_10ace, have recently shared the details of the upcoming smartphone.
Going through the leaked image of the upcoming Vivo X300 Pro, ACE_10ace has shared a couple of alleged Vivo X300 Pro renders and it reveals that the design is not changed as the phone has a large circular camera module on the back at the centre position.
It seems that the device features three lenses and a sensor. Vivo will also use the ZEISS T* lens coating that will be offering improved camera experience with more clarity and reduced image distortion.
The upcoming Vivo phone is expected to come with the power of the upcoming Dimensity 9500 mobile processor and the device is expected to feature a flat 6.8-inch display with a 1.5K resolution.
It is also reported that the upcoming Vivo X300 Pro will house a 7,000mAh battery. The device is also expected to come with a 50MP main camera, a 50MP ultra-wide lens, and a 200MP periscope telephoto camera. The main sensor is Sony’s new LYT-828, a 1/1.28-inch 50MP sensor with 1.22μm pixels. The upcoming device will also feature Hybrid Frame-HDR.
